IP查询
查询
你查询的IP:[125.62.122.204] 地理位置:印度
最新查询
58.128.16.86
220.160.68.75
221.208.24.41
121.204.127.98
119.28.3.91
123.4.14.240
124.126.157.182
59.64.229.89
117.59.73.179
125.62.122.204
210.2.122.48
119.254.207.108
123.52.70.15
116.213.64.42
118.228.20.0
124.196.77.165
119.15.136.122
202.127.37.203
202.122.112.205
59.155.107.54
210.5.144.214
210.14.128.181
219.242.234.205
123.184.40.45
118.212.178.158
221.12.70.215
203.212.15.250
218.56.169.195
125.61.128.236
121.89.48.111
122.144.128.45